Blayde MacRonan |
Warduke was written up as a fighter even in Dungeon 105 (18th as opposed to his being 8th level in both the adventure Quest for the Heartsone and Shady Dragon Inn supplement for D&D). He has acted in the role of assassin for those with the money to pay him or even the Horned Society, but he has always been a fighter.
Cavalier could be a way to go with him. Heck, I can even see him as an antipaladin.
But if you're going to use Warduke, then his nemesis Strongheart the paladin should be around to offer the PCs insight into his former friend.
Cthulhudrew |
To play off of Blayde's suggestion above, in Golarion I'd probably have Warduke as a former Mendevian Crusader, who became disillusioned by endless war and ended up becoming the leader of a band of raiders who scavenge and pillage (like their leader, the self-named "Duke of War", they wear piecemeal armor they've picked up from foes and demon-slaughtered remnants).
His fellow former crusader, Strongheart, still fights the good fight, as well as attempting to oppose Warduke's depredations when and where he can.
As far as a class? You could certainly go Anti-Paladin if you really want to play him off against Strongheart, but I'd probably keep him as a Fighter, myself. (Heresy, I know.)
